    I had my car tuned on a dyno with the SCT program. Much more hp and better gas milage. But the best was the program for the auto trans. 1st to 2nd is much harder now and it won't drop into overdrive as soon, or having to drop back a gear searching for the performance when the throttle is added a little bit.   8. Ford announces pricing for 2007 Edge

     

    Oakville, Ontario - Ford has announced pricing for its all-new, Canadian-built 2007 Edge crossover, which will start at $32,999.

     

    The Edge will be released in four models, starting with the SE in front-wheel drive for $32,999; the SEL starts at $35,999. In all-wheel drive, the Edge is priced at $34,999 in SE trim, and $37,999 in SEL trim. Available options will include $500 18-inch painted aluminum wheels, $320 reverse sending system, $1,700 Vista sunroof, $1,200 DVD entertainment system and DVD navigation system ($2,700 on SE, $2,300 on SEL).

     

    All Edge models are powered by a 3.5-litre V6 with six-speed automatic transmission, and include standard Advance Trac stability program with roll stability control, and side and curtain airbags. The Edge will also share its platform with the Lincoln MKX; both will be built at the company's plant in Oakville, Ontario
